Kumara Parvatha TrekSTARTING POINT: Kukke SubramanyaENDING POINT: Kumara Parvatha PeakDIFFICULTY LEVEL: HardTREK DISTANCE: 28 KMBEST SEASON: Post-Monsoon & WinterThe Kumara Parvatha trek is one of the most difficult yet exhilarating treks of Karnataka. The path goes through thick jungles, open grasslands and then starts a severe ascent up the steep mountain. On the summit, a view that will leave you spellbound is waiting for you. It's an almost 360-degree view of the Western Ghats, with a blanket of green spread all around, which makes it absolutely worthwhile. This trek is recommended for advanced trekkers. Tadiandamol TrekSTARTING POINT: KakkabeENDING POINT: Tadiandamol PeakDIFFICULTY LEVEL: ModerateTREK DISTANCE: 14 KMBEST SEASON: Post-Monsoon & WinterTadiandamol, the highest peak in Coorg, is a gorgeous trekking route of emerald green forests, lush green meadows, and mist-laden mountains. This isn't very difficult compared to other trekking trails in the Western Ghats, which makes it the perfect trekking trail for families and beginner trekkers. An awe-inspiring view of nearby valleys and peaks can be seen from the top of Tadiandamol. Savandurga TrekSTARTING POINT: Savandurga BaseENDING POINT: Savandurga SummitDIFFICULTY LEVEL: ModerateTREK DISTANCE: 4 KMBEST SEASON: Winter & Early SummerThe largest monolithic hill in Asia, Savandurga, is also a great day trip for a trek from Bangalore. The ascent involves a lot of climbing up rocks and vertical walls and has good views of the lake and the forest from the summit. Madhugiri TrekSTARTING POINT: Madhugiri Fort BaseENDING POINT: Madhugiri PeakDIFFICULTY LEVEL: ModerateTREK DISTANCE: 4 KMBEST SEASON: WinterTrekking up Madhugiri means Trekking to the 2nd largest monolith in Asia. Trekking along the historical walls, gates, stones steps of the Madhugiri Fort is the trekking path which itself is a great story. The panorama of hills and terrain of stone from the top of the fort is an unforgettable experience for trekkers and history buffs. Kudremukh TrekSTARTING POINT: Mullodi VillageENDING POINT: Kudremukh PeakDIFFICULTY LEVEL: HardTREK DISTANCE: 22 KMBEST SEASON: Post-Monsoon & WinterA delightful but slightly arduous trek to take up in Karnataka is the trek to Kudremukh. It winds through shola forests, streambeds and then into the rolling grasslands till you reach the peak, which resembles a horse's face. It is on the peak of Kudremukh, and that too on the summit, that you get to experience the vast, unending rolling hills and misty valleys that characterise Kudremukh, making it so unique. It does take a long while for you to reach the summit of the slope, and that can be monotonous, which is what also adds to the sweet sense of achievement at the end. Kodachadri TrekSTARTING POINT: NitturENDING POINT: Kodachadri PeakDIFFICULTY LEVEL: Moderate to HardTREK DISTANCE: 14 KMBEST SEASON: Post-Monsoon & WinterThe Kodachadri trek is a wonderful and adventurous experience as you will encounter deep green woods, waterfalls and undulating hills. On a bright, non-misty day, the vista from the peak is a remarkable sight of the Arabian Sea and is an experience that is considered the best in Karnataka. As you trek through the abundant flora and fauna, you also get to witness lovely sunsets. Activity Location: Savandurga Hills, BangaloreStart time: 11:00 PMEnd time: 01:00 PMSavandurga Trek Distance: 4 kmSavandurga Height: 4,022 ft.Trek Difficulty: ModerateDistance from Bangalore: 70 KmAbout Savandurga Sunrise Trek:The Savandurga is located near Bengaluru, India, and is a popular destination for adventure seekers. Savandurga itself is one of the largest monolithic hills in Asia, offering a unique and challenging trekking experience. The Savandurga trek typically involves navigating rocky terrain and steep inclines, making it a moderately difficult trek. The trek offers stunning panoramic views of the surrounding landscape, including the Arkavathi River and lush greenery. Trekkers on the Savandurga will encounter historical ruins, adding a layer of intrigue to the adventure. The Savandurga trek usually takes around 2-3 hours to ascend, depending on the chosen route and pace. There are two main routes for the trek: the Karigudda (Black Hill) route, which is more challenging, and the Biligudda (White Hill) route, which is relatively easier and often preferred by beginners. The trek is a rewarding experience, offering a blend of physical challenge and natural beauty. For those planning the Savandurga trek, it's recommended to wear sturdy trekking shoes and carry sufficient water. Activity location: Coorg, KarnatakaStarting day: FridayEnd day: SundayTadiandamol Height: 5,735 ft.Tadiandamol Trek Distance: 10 km (both ways) Trek Difficulty: Moderate to Difficult Distance from Bangalore: 265 KmAbout Tadiandamol Trek, Coorg: Tadiandamol Trekking Trail in Karnataka is one of the most beloved trails for novice and experienced trekkers alike, drawing trekkers from around India. Situated in Kodagu (Coorg), this trek provides spectacular views of the Western Ghats as well as lush forest surroundings. Starting this trek through the shola forests will be an enjoyable journey, with cool air and bird songs providing a relaxing start. These pristine forests are home to numerous species of flora and fauna - you might spot exotic butterflies or even one of the Nilgiri langur or Malabar giant squirrel. After some time, you come upon a small stream that allows for barefoot crossing. Enjoy its cool water as you enjoy walking alongside it. After this point, the forest trail becomes increasingly steeper; during monsoon season, mud can become treacherous, so we recommend wearing quality trekking shoes and carrying trekking poles to stay on course. As your trek progresses, you quickly reach a boulder point. From here, you can spot a hillock which serves as a false peak of Tadiandamol; its true peak lies much further to the left or the south side. There is also a trail marker from the forest department here showing you how to reach its summit. Start your journey early so you can enjoy a glorious sunrise view from the summit, while also avoiding midday heat and crowds. Consider hiring a local guide who can share fascinating tales of local flora and fauna while keeping within Leave No Trace guidelines to protect our environment. Activity location: Coorg, KarnatakaStarting day: FridayEnd day: SundayKumara Parvatha Trek Distance: 14 km (both ways) Trek Difficulty: Moderate to Difficult Kumara Parvatha Height: 5,617 ft. Distance from Bangalore: 270 KmAbout Kumara Parvatha Trek, Coorg: Kumara Parvatha Trekking can be one of the most rewarding treks a trekker can embark on. Boasting challenging gradients and stunning Western Ghat views, this trek will test both your physical and mental limits while helping you grow both personally and physically stronger. Beedahalli, home of the revered Kumara Parvatha temple, marks the starting point of this trail with its small gate and board marking its starting point. From here, it progressively becomes steeper as one progresses on this trek. As soon as you reach the summit of Kumara Parvatha, take in its breathtaking panoramas from up top. Take some time to soak in this experience before beginning to descend the mountain; don't forget to visit the shrine on top if desired and offer your prayers as well! Kumara Parvatha should be hiked during post-monsoon and winter months from October to February, when the Western Ghats come alive with lush vegetation, vibrant streams & waterfalls, and rejuvenated streams & waterfalls. Activity location: Kodachadri, ShimogaStarting day: FridayEnd day: SundayKodachadri Trek Distance: 10 kmTrek Difficulty: Moderate to Difficult Kodachadri Height: 5,735 ft. (1,343 m)Distance from Bangalore: 380 KmAbout Kodachadri Trek, Shimoga: Kodachadri trek offers an ideal setting for nature enthusiasts and wildlife enthusiasts. Home to numerous plant and animal species, its wilderness setting makes for a memorable wildlife viewing experience. The trek is moderate in difficulty and requires good fitness levels and endurance. Before beginning the trek, it is vital to prepare your body by practising yoga and stretching muscles - this will reduce muscle aches and fatigue during your trek! Additionally, drinking plenty of water and carbohydrates is also key to fueling your body properly during its journey. Hidlumane Falls are one of the many sights worth seeing during this trek; these seven waterfalls cascading from mountain pinnacles make an impressive sight during monsoon season. Moola Mukambika Temple can be found at the summit of Kodachadri hill and is dedicated to Goddess Mookambika, who is said to have killed the demon Mookasura. Additionally, Adi Shankaracharya meditated at this location, making it an important spiritual site. Once at the summit, trekkers can take in breathtaking views of the surrounding hills and valleys as well as witness an exhilarating sunset from this point. Additionally, an ancient fort nearby offers another opportunity for discovery if desired. Hikers must remember that this trail forms part of Mookambika Wildlife Sanctuary and should take great care not to disturb or harm any of its wildlife. Looking for similar overnight adventures? Activity location: Chikkamagaluru, KarnatakaStarting day: FridayEnd day: SundayMullayanagiri Trek Distance: 5 - 6 KMTrek Difficulty: Moderate to Difficult Mullayanagiri Height: 6,330 ft. (1,925 m)Distance from Bangalore: 280 KmAbout Mullayanagiri Peak Trek: The Mullayanagiri trek is one of the premier hiking experiences in Chikmagalur, offering stunning views and abundant vegetation that will leave you feeling rejuvenated and renewed. Perfect for enjoying nature on weekends! Mullayanagiri Peak, Karnataka's highest point, provides magnificent sweeping views across the Western Ghats from its summit. Additionally, this hill hosts a small Shiva temple on its summit. To access it from Sarpadhari (white arch off main road that marks start of hike), begin your ascent along a trail with steep inclines up to 60 degrees initially, but then it gets gradually easier as your hike progresses, giving you more time to take in breathtaking landscapes along the way. For an unforgettable Mullayanagiri trekking experience, the monsoon season from September to February is ideal. At this time of year, the surrounding landscape transforms into an ethereal, lush green paradise and is often shrouded by mist, creating an almost otherworldly effect. However, summer temperatures and humidity levels may make trekking unpleasant; to ensure your experience remains safe and enjoyable it is advised that you travel with an experienced guide; they can suggest when and how best to visit this magical mountain as well as assist with planning an itinerary and any additional activities that might enhance it during your visit. Activity Location: Chikkamagaluru, Karnataka Starting Day: FridayEnd Day: SundayKudremukh Height: 2,674 FtKudremukh Trek Distance: 18 kmTrek Difficulty: Moderate to Difficult Distance from Bangalore: 330 KmAbout Kudremukh Trek, Chikmagalur: Kudremukh Trek offers the ideal weekend escape from Bangalore. Filled with dense Shola forests, numerous streams, bamboo plants that reach up into the sky and lush green meadows - this trek makes an excellent photographer's playground! Additionally, during the monsoon and winter seasons, this path becomes even more breathtakingly beautiful. Trekkers can enjoy the lush beauty of this trail and spot wild animals like barking deer, lion-tailed macaques, Malabar giant squirrels and leopards along the route. Additionally, this trekking adventure provides breathtaking panoramic views of rolling hills and lush valleys that are sure to please nature enthusiasts alike. Kudremukh is one of the premier trekking trails in the Western Ghats, famed for its lush forests and breathtaking vistas. Although a difficult and rewarding hike that requires patience, endurance, and mental fortitude to complete successfully, Kudremukh nonetheless rewards you with breathtaking views from its cloud-covered peak at its conclusion! The trail begins at the Forest Department Office, where permits and guides must be obtained before beginning to trek across coffee plantations and muddy roads with waterfalls to reach Ontimara for your first glimpse of the forest. Once in the forest, the path becomes steeper and more difficult to traverse. After travelling a short distance, however, you'll reach a flat area covered by an impressive stand-alone tree where seating arrangements have been put in place so that you may rest at this scenic locale. Activity location: Madugundi, Karnataka Starting day: FridayEnd day: SundayBandaje Falls Height: 700 m Bandaje Falls Trek Distance: 9 - 12 km Trek Difficulty: Moderate to Difficult Distance from Bangalore: 308 KmAbout Bandaje Falls Trek, Dakshina Kannada:If you're searching for an exhilarating monsoon trek near Bangalore, the Bandaje Falls trek offers an exhilarating weekend adventure. Boasting scenic trails, an ancient fort and breathtaking sunrise views - its centrepiece is undoubtedly Bandaje Arbi waterfall - an incredible natural marvel that stands as testament to nature's splendour. Start your trek off right with an enjoyable drive through mist-covered roads and lush countryside, stopping briefly in Ujire before arriving at Mundaje village - your starting point. Surrounded by dense forests and towering trees that create natural tunnels overhead while filtering sunlight onto the ground below, Mundaje village promises an escape from city life as you begin trekking through its lush jungle environment. As you journey through the dense forest, you will reach Ballalarayana Durga Fort perched atop a hill, providing breathtaking views and access to ancient relics. Once finished exploring this marvel, head towards Bandaje Falls; this magnificent sight consists of cascading falls crashing over cliffs before plunging into a lush gorge below; an experience which will leave you speechless!
